University of Kent Moodle notice and takedown request

The University of Kent will, upon notification, consider removing any material from University of Kent Moodle on receipt of a complaint.

Grounds for complaint

Complaints include contact from the owner or representative of the owner with intellectual property rights in all or part of the resource; the creator of all or part of the resource who has moral rights or any individual or organisation who believes that any of the material held in the University of Kent Moodle repository is in some way illegal.

Complaints will include notice of:

  • unauthorised use by reason of reproduction and/or making available the protected material
  • breach of the moral right (e.g. paternity/integrity/right not to have work subjected to derogatory treatment)
  • issues on grounds other than copyright and/or related rights (e.g. defamation, breach of confidence, data protection)

On receipt of complaint

On receipt of the complaint, Information Services will make an initial assessment of the validity of the complaint and will acknowledge its receipt.

Where the complaint is valid and to be pursued, the content that is subject to complaint will be temporarily removed from University of Kent Moodle pending an agreed solution.

Information Services will then contact the contributor of the material and inform them that the item is subject to complaint, under what allegations and they will be encouraged to assuage the complainants concerns. Information Services will spend a reasonable amount of time attempting to resolve the problem by mediating between the complainant and the contributor. All attempts will be made to resolve the issue swiftly and amicably to the satisfaction of both the complainant and the contributor.

If a resolution is found through mediating between the parties, this will be enacted/initiated. This will involve one of the following outcomes:

  • the resource need not be changed (the resource is replaced in University of Kent Moodle)
  • the resource is replaced in University of Kent Moodle with changes or made restricted access
  • the resource must be permanently removed from University of Kent Moodle
